Add 6/72 and 42/10
1st number: 6/72, 2nd number: 4 2/10
6/72 + 42/10 is 257/60.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 72 and 10 is 360
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 360 - For the 1st fraction, since 72 × 5 = 360,
6/72 = 6 × 5/72 × 5 = 30/360 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 10 × 36 = 360,
42/10 = 42 × 36/10 × 36 = 1512/360 - Add the two like fractions:
30/360 + 1512/360 = 30 + 1512/360 = 1542/360 - 1542/360 simplified gives 257/60
- So, 6/72 + 42/10 = 257/60
In mixed form: 417/60
